A Study On The Conception Of Selecting Son-in-Law Of The Scholar-Officials In The Tang Dynasty

The scholar-officials was the intellectual and elite class in the Tang Dynasty.Unmarried women as an indispensable part of the scholar-officials,the choice of their spouses often represented the value orientation on marriage issues of their whole family.When choosing a son-in-law,the scholar-officials in Tang Dynasty often considered the family background,good personal characteristics and political and economic benefits that the son-in-law could bring to themselves.In the early period of Tang Dynasty,the social atmosphere of valuing family status of Wei and Jin Dynasties continued,and the conception of valuing family status was deeply rooted.Therefore,valuing family background was the main conception of selecting son-in-law in the scholar-officials in this period.In the middle of Tang Dynasty,with the gradual improvement and development of the imperial examination system,the old scholar-officials began to decline,and the influence of the conception of family status on the conception of selecting son-in-law of the scholar-officials began to weaken.The conception that emphasized talent,scholarly honor won in imperial competitive examination and economic interests emerged gradually,thus the conception of selecting son-in-law of scholar-officials in this period showed the characteristics of diversification.In the late Tang Dynasty,the imperial examination system was further improved and developed,the old scholar-officials declined,and the new scholar-officials gradually became powerful.Although the conception of family status in marriage still existed,the conception of choosing son-in-law,which emphasized talents,scholarly honor won in imperial competitive examination and political and economic interests,became the mainstream criteria of selecting son-in-law in this period.Although the content and evolution of the conception of selecting son-in-law of the whole scholar-officials class were the same,the conception of selecting son-in-law of the new and old scholar-officials had their own characteristics.On the whole,the old scholar-officials paid more attention to their family social status,whilethe new scholar-officials paid more attention to their good personal characteristics such as knowledge,morality,talent and scholarly honor won in imperial competitive examination.Both the new and old scholar-officials had the criteria of valuing interests,but the old scholar-officials mainly valued the economic interests,while the new scholar-officials focused on the political interests;In the middle and late Tang Dynasty,the conception of selecting son-in-law of the scholar-officials began to change from the emphasis on family status to the emphasis on talents and scholarly honor won in imperial competitive examination.However,the change of the new scholar-officials was earlier than that of the old one,and the change speed was also faster.The evolution of the conception of selecting son-in-law in different periods of Tang Dynasty and the different characteristics of the conception of selecting son-in-law between the new and the old scholar-officials were related to the social hierarchy,social customs and the gradual improvement and development of the imperial examination system at that time.
